InternalPipelineOptions interface
Définit les options utilisées pour configurer les options internes du pipeline HTTP pour un client SDK.
- Extends
Propriétés
decompress |
Configurer s’il faut décompresser la réponse en fonction de Accept-Encoding'en-tête (node-fetch uniquement) |
deserialization |
Options permettant de configurer la désérialisation de la réponse d’API. |
logging |
Options pour configurer la journalisation des requêtes/réponses. |
send |
Envoyez des charges utiles JSON Array en tant que NDJSON. |
Propriétés héritées
http |
Implémentation HttpClient à utiliser pour les requêtes HTTP sortantes. La valeur par défaut est DefaultHttpClient. |
keep |
Options pour la façon dont les connexions HTTP doivent être gérées pour les requêtes futures. |
proxy |
Options permettant de configurer un proxy pour les requêtes sortantes. |
redirect |
Options pour la façon dont les réponses de redirection sont gérées. |
retry |
Options qui contrôlent comment réessayer les demandes ayant échoué. |
user |
Options permettant d’ajouter les détails de l’agent utilisateur aux requêtes sortantes. |
Détails de la propriété
decompressResponse
Configurer s’il faut décompresser la réponse en fonction de Accept-Encoding'en-tête (node-fetch uniquement)
decompressResponse?: boolean
Valeur de propriété
boolean
deserializationOptions
Options permettant de configurer la désérialisation de la réponse d’API.
deserializationOptions?: DeserializationOptions
Valeur de propriété
loggingOptions
Options pour configurer la journalisation des requêtes/réponses.
loggingOptions?: LogPolicyOptions
Valeur de propriété
sendStreamingJson
Envoyez des charges utiles JSON Array en tant que NDJSON.
sendStreamingJson?: boolean
Valeur de propriété
boolean
Détails de la propriété héritée
httpClient
Implémentation HttpClient à utiliser pour les requêtes HTTP sortantes. La valeur par défaut est DefaultHttpClient.
httpClient?: HttpClient
Valeur de propriété
Hérité dePipelineOptions.httpClient
keepAliveOptions
Options pour la façon dont les connexions HTTP doivent être gérées pour les requêtes futures.
keepAliveOptions?: KeepAliveOptions
Valeur de propriété
Hérité dePipelineOptions.keepAliveOptions
proxyOptions
Options permettant de configurer un proxy pour les requêtes sortantes.
proxyOptions?: ProxySettings
Valeur de propriété
Hérité dePipelineOptions.proxyOptions
redirectOptions
Options pour la façon dont les réponses de redirection sont gérées.
redirectOptions?: RedirectOptions
Valeur de propriété
Hérité dePipelineOptions.redirectOptions
retryOptions
Options qui contrôlent comment réessayer les demandes ayant échoué.
retryOptions?: RetryOptions
Valeur de propriété
Hérité dePipelineOptions.retryOptions
userAgentOptions
Options permettant d’ajouter les détails de l’agent utilisateur aux requêtes sortantes.
userAgentOptions?: UserAgentOptions
Valeur de propriété
Hérité dePipelineOptions.userAgentOptions